> Uhm, David, why does this need to be compiled for ELF? Isn't this used
> exclusively for creating a.out shared libraries?
Yes, it is only for *creating* a.out libraries, but that doesn't mean
it can't be ELF. A better question is if virtually everything else is
ELF, why shouldn't this be as well? The same goes for the aout-gcc
and aout-binutils packages.
